WASHINGTON, Feb. 12 (Xinhuanet) -- Ten churches in the southern U.S. state of Alabama have been set on fire since Feb. 2, and the latest fire at a Baptist church was ruled arson, local media reported Sunday.
The latest fire on Saturday severely damaged the Beaverton Freewill Baptist Church in northwest Alabama, and the state fire marshal's office ruled it arson.
The fire marshal's office was investigating whether the fire was connected to the other fires that have destroyed or damaged nine other rural churches in the state since early this month.
Alabama Governor Bob Riley said last week that the church fires appeared linked, and federal investigators said on Sunday that based on witness accounts and other evidence, they believed two white men were responsible for the fires. Enditem |
